Abstract

本实用新型公开了一种手术室用便携式保温箱,包括药液瓶,还包括箱体、隔热板、加热灯、隔离网、隔板、滑槽、箱盖、便携把手、第一温度传感器、第二温度传感器,该手术室用便携式保温箱,结构巧妙,功能强大,通过使用该装置,不仅能够对相应药品进行有效的加热保温,还能够通过简单的操作,将该装置进行方便的携带,从而便于医护人员拿取相应药品对患者进行使用,提高了医护人员操作的便捷性,也给患者手术带来便利。

The utility model discloses a portable incubator for an operating room, which includes a liquid medicine bottle, a box body, a heat insulation board, a heating lamp, an isolation net, a partition, a chute, a box cover, a portable handle, and a first temperature sensor. , The second temperature sensor, the portable incubator used in the operating room, has an ingenious structure and powerful functions. By using this device, not only can the corresponding medicine be effectively heated and kept warm, but also the device can be carried conveniently through simple operations. , so that it is convenient for medical staff to take corresponding medicines and use them on patients, which improves the convenience of medical staff's operation and also brings convenience to patients' operations.

背景技术Background technique

现临床手术过程中,术中低体温发生率50~70%,低体温对机体的影响有增加手术部位感染风险,导致寒战耗氧量增加,延长麻醉时间以及血栓形成等,为减少低体温发生率,保证术中护理安全,通常医护人员会预先将患者所需输入液体,如消毒液、冲洗液等进行加热,而目前传统的加热装置多为加热柜,普遍体积较大,且都为固定式,无法方便携带,当患者需要使用时,不便医护人员随时拿取,从而在影响了医护人员操作的同时,也给患者手术带来隐患,鉴于以上缺陷,实有必要设计一种手术室用便携式保温箱。In the current clinical operation process, the incidence of intraoperative hypothermia is 50-70%. The impact of hypothermia on the body increases the risk of infection at the surgical site, leading to chills, increased oxygen consumption, prolonged anesthesia time, and thrombosis. In order to reduce the occurrence of hypothermia The rate is high to ensure the safety of nursing during the operation. Usually, the medical staff will pre-heat the liquid required by the patient, such as disinfectant, flushing liquid, etc., but the current traditional heating devices are mostly heating cabinets, which are generally large in size and fixed. When the patient needs to use it, it is inconvenient for the medical staff to take it at any time, which affects the operation of the medical staff and also brings hidden dangers to the operation of the patient. In view of the above defects, it is necessary to design an operating room. Portable incubator.

实用新型内容Utility model content

本实用新型所要解决的技术问题在于:提供一种手术室用便携式保温箱,来解决目前传统加热柜,因体积较大,无法方便携带,不便医护人员随时拿取的问题。The technical problem to be solved by the utility model is to provide a portable incubator for an operating room to solve the problem that the traditional heating cabinet is too large to be easily carried, and it is inconvenient for medical staff to take it at any time.

为解决上述技术问题,本实用新型的技术方案是:一种手术室用便携式保温箱,包括药液瓶,还包括箱体、隔热板、加热灯、隔离网、隔板、滑槽、箱盖、便携把手、第一温度传感器、第二温度传感器,所述的隔热板位于箱体内部底端,所述的隔热板与箱体螺纹相连,所述的加热灯位于隔热板顶部,所述的加热灯与隔热板螺纹相连,所述的隔离网位于箱体内部下端,所述的隔离网与箱体螺纹相连,所述的隔板数量为若干件,所述的隔板从左至右依次分布于箱体内部上端,所述的隔板与箱体螺纹相连,所述的滑槽数量为若干件,所述的滑槽分别位于箱体和隔板顶部,所述的滑槽分别与箱体和隔板胶水一体相连,所述的箱盖数量为若干件,所述的箱盖位于滑槽两两之间,所述的箱盖与滑槽滑动相连,所述的便携把手位于箱体顶部,所述的便携把手与箱体转动相连,所述的第一温度传感器位于箱体内部左侧中端,所述的第一温度传感器与箱体螺纹相连,所述的第二温度传感器位于箱体内部右侧中端,所述的第二温度传感器与箱体螺纹相连。In order to solve the above technical problems, the technical solution of the utility model is: a portable incubator for operating room, including liquid medicine bottle, box body, heat insulation board, heating lamp, isolation net, partition, chute, box Cover, portable handle, first temperature sensor, second temperature sensor, the heat shield is located at the inner bottom of the box, the heat shield is connected to the box with threads, and the heating lamp is located at the top of the heat shield , the heating lamp is threadedly connected with the heat shield, the isolation net is located at the lower end of the box, the isolation net is threaded with the box body, the number of the partitions is several pieces, and the partition Distributed at the upper end of the box from left to right, the partitions are connected to the box by threads, and the number of the chutes is several pieces, and the chutes are respectively located on the top of the box and the partition. The chute is integrally connected with the box body and the clapboard glue respectively, the number of the box covers is several pieces, the box covers are located between two chutes, the box covers are slidingly connected with the chute, The portable handle is located on the top of the box, the portable handle is connected to the box in rotation, the first temperature sensor is located at the middle end on the left side inside the box, the first temperature sensor is connected to the box thread, and the The second temperature sensor is located at the middle end on the right side inside the box, and the second temperature sensor is connected with the box by threads.

进一步,所述的箱体外壁四周还设有保温罩,所述的保温罩与箱体一体相连。Further, a heat preservation cover is provided around the outer wall of the box, and the heat preservation cover is integrally connected with the box body.

进一步,所述的箱体与保温罩之间还设有若干数量的加强板,所述的加强板分别与箱体和保温罩一体相连。Further, a number of reinforcement plates are provided between the box body and the heat preservation cover, and the reinforcement plates are integrally connected with the box body and the heat preservation cover respectively.

进一步,所述的保温罩右侧上端还设有蓄电池,所述的蓄电池与保温罩螺纹相连。Further, a storage battery is provided at the upper right side of the heat preservation cover, and the storage battery is threadedly connected with the heat preservation cover.

进一步,所述的保温罩右侧下端还设有充电接口,所述的充电接口与保温罩螺纹相连,且所述的充电接口与蓄电池导线相连。Further, the lower right side of the heat preservation cover is also provided with a charging interface, the charging interface is threadedly connected to the heat preservation cover, and the charging interface is connected to the battery wire.

进一步,所述的保温罩前端左侧还设有温控器,所述的温控器与保温罩螺纹相连,且所述的温控器与蓄电池导线相连。Further, a temperature controller is provided on the left side of the front end of the heat preservation cover, the temperature controller is connected to the heat preservation cover by threads, and the temperature controller is connected to the battery wire.

进一步,所述的保温罩前端右侧还设有开关,所述的开关与保温罩螺纹相连。Further, a switch is provided on the right side of the front end of the heat preservation cover, and the switch is threadedly connected with the heat preservation cover.

与现有技术相比,该手术室用便携式保温箱,根据所需加热保温药液瓶大小,医护人员将相应箱盖从滑槽内向外抽出,再将药液瓶放入箱体内,再将箱盖重新插入滑槽内,即实现了箱体的密封,然后医护人员便可打开开关,使加热灯、温控器、第一温度传感器以及第二温度传感器同时开启,即加热灯开启后,对箱体内部进行加热,即使箱体内部温度上升,从而达到对药液瓶的加热,同步,医护人员可通过操作温控器,对第一温度传感器检测温度下限值进行设定,再操作温控器,对第二温度传感器检测温度上限值进行设定,当箱体内部温度超过第二温度传感器检测温度上限值时,通过第二温度传感器的作用,使加热灯停止工作,当箱体内部温度低于第一温度传感器检测温度下限值时,通过第一温度传感器的作用,使加热灯开启,即加热灯重新对箱体内部进行加热,最终通过以上方式,使得箱体内部温度始终处于医护人员所需温度值,当患者需要进行手术时,医护人员便可握住便携把手,因便携把手与箱体为转动相连,从而使得医护人员能够转动便携把手,然后通过便携把手,将该装置整体提起,再将该装置随身携带至患者身边,当患者需要使用时,医护人员便可进行方便的拿取,该手术室用便携式保温箱,结构巧妙,功能强大,通过使用该装置,不仅能够对相应药品进行有效的加热保温,还能够通过简单的操作,将该装置进行方便的携带,从而便于医护人员拿取相应药品对患者进行使用,提高了医护人员操作的便捷性,也给患者手术带来便利,同时,隔热板是为了阻挡加热灯热量传递到箱体底部,对箱体进行有效的保护,蓄电池是为了给温控器、加热灯、第一温度传感器以及第二温度传感器提供能量的供应,使得该装置能够无线使用,便于该装置移动,充电接口是为了连接外部电源,使得外部电源能够通过充电接口对蓄电池进行充电,因蓄电池与温控器、加热灯、第一温度传感器以及第二温度传感器都为导线相连,从而实现了能量的正常供应。Compared with the prior art, the portable incubator used in the operating room, according to the size of the required heated and insulated liquid medicine bottle, the medical staff pulls out the corresponding box cover from the chute, puts the liquid medicine bottle into the box, and then Reinsert the box cover into the chute, which realizes the sealing of the box body, and then the medical staff can turn on the switch, so that the heating lamp, the temperature controller, the first temperature sensor and the second temperature sensor are turned on at the same time, that is, after the heating lamp is turned on , to heat the inside of the box, even if the temperature inside the box rises, so as to heat the liquid medicine bottle. Synchronously, the medical staff can set the lower limit of the detection temperature of the first temperature sensor by operating the thermostat, and then Operate the thermostat to set the upper limit of the temperature detected by the second temperature sensor. When the internal temperature of the box exceeds the upper limit of the temperature detected by the second temperature sensor, the heating lamp will stop working through the action of the second temperature sensor. When the temperature inside the box is lower than the lower limit of the temperature detected by the first temperature sensor, the heating lamp is turned on through the action of the first temperature sensor, that is, the heating lamp reheats the inside of the box, and finally through the above methods, the box The internal temperature is always at the temperature required by the medical staff. When the patient needs to perform an operation, the medical staff can hold the portable handle, because the portable handle is connected to the box in rotation, so that the medical staff can turn the portable handle, and then pass the portable handle. , lift the device as a whole, and then carry the device to the patient. When the patient needs to use it, the medical staff can take it conveniently. The portable incubator for the operating room has an ingenious structure and powerful functions. By using this The device can not only effectively heat and keep the corresponding medicines, but also can carry the device conveniently through simple operation, so that it is convenient for the medical staff to take the corresponding medicines and use them on the patients, which improves the convenience of the medical staff's operation. It also brings convenience to the patient's operation. At the same time, the heat shield is to prevent the heat from the heating lamp from being transferred to the bottom of the box, and effectively protect the box. The second temperature sensor provides energy supply, so that the device can be used wirelessly, which is convenient for the device to move. The charging interface is to connect the external power supply, so that the external power supply can charge the battery through the charging interface. Because the battery is connected with the temperature controller, heating lamp, Both the first temperature sensor and the second temperature sensor are connected by wires, thereby realizing the normal supply of energy.
